† Treasury footnote: Of this £16,945,000 an amount of £8,500,000 is required for use in London and Australia.
‡ For balance of exchange, being cost of exchange on London funds required for normal requirements, see page 229.
§ Against this, Treasury bills amounting to £5,700,000 were outstanding.
|| Against this, Treasury bills under the Public Revenues Act, 1926, section 41, amounting to £6,991,328 are outstanding. Further Treasury bills amounting to £11,306,047 under the Banks Indemnity (Exchange) Act, 1932–33, are also outstanding, but £1,000,000 is held against these bills in the New Zealand Government Indemnity Exchange Account, London.
